Schottky Diodes
Features
• For general pur pose applications.
The SD101 ser ies is a metal-on-silicon Schottky
barrier device which is protected by a PN junction
guard ring.
The low forward voltage drop and fast switching
make it ideal for protection of MOS devices,
steering, biasing, and coupling diodes for fast
switching and low logic level applications.
This diode is also available in the MiniMELF case
with the type designations LL101A to LL101C,
the DO-35 case with the type designations
SD101A to SD101C and the SOD-123 case with
type designations SD101AW to SD101CW.
